CareerPath
Game Developer : Responsible for writing and implementing the code that creates the gaming experience.
Strong demand for programming skills in languages such as C# and C++.
Game Designer : Focuses on creating the content and rules of the game.
Critical for ensuring engaging gameplay and player experiences.
Quality Assurance Tester : Tests games for bugs and ensures quality before release.
Essential role for maintaining high standards in gaming.
Project Manager : Oversees game development projects, coordinating teams and ensuring deadlines are met.
Requires excellent leadership and organizational skills.
Marketing Specialist : Develops strategies to promote games and engage with target audiences.
Vital for the financial success of gaming products.
Data Analyst : Analyzes player data to inform game design and marketing strategies.
Increasingly important as data-driven decision-making becomes prevalent.
User Experience Researcher : Studies player interactions to enhance usability and enjoyment.
Plays a key role in creating intuitive gaming interfaces.
Other Roles : Includes various positions such as community managers, sound designers, and technical artists, contributing to diverse aspects of the gaming ecosystem.
